Transaction 103cbf86e6934aacadbe2424cac4e949f9cad2d2a62bfa175e0c938a67ae27b1

1 Input
2 Outputs
  • 103cbf86e6934aacadbe2424cac4e949f9cad2d2a62bfa175e0c938a67ae27b1:0
  • value  131564
    address  17HtUF1rZeHyCMxnCKLGHhiwsS8iku8UVF
  • 103cbf86e6934aacadbe2424cac4e949f9cad2d2a62bfa175e0c938a67ae27b1:1
  • value  61296
    address  bc1q24ukvrxvzt2v27w78vyz4nl7wg3s3sy0ggh2v5